1、jQuery通過name獲取對象的方法是:使用jQuery獲取name=nw的input對象:$(input[name=nw]);使用$(input[name=nw]).val()方法或$(input[name=nw]).html()方法來獲取其值。
網(wǎng)站的建設(shè)成都創(chuàng)新互聯(lián)公司專注網(wǎng)站定制,經(jīng)驗(yàn)豐富,不做模板,主營網(wǎng)站定制開發(fā).小程序定制開發(fā),H5頁面制作!給你煥然一新的設(shè)計(jì)體驗(yàn)!已為白烏魚等企業(yè)提供專業(yè)服務(wù)。
2、jQuery如此之好用,和其在獲取對象時使用與CSS選擇器兼容的語法有很大關(guān)系,畢竟CSS選擇器大家都很熟悉(關(guān)于CSS選擇器可以看看十分鐘搞定CSS選擇器),但其強(qiáng)大在兼容了CSS3的選擇器,甚至多出了很多。
3、例如,可以通過以下方式獲取一個 jQuery 對象:var $elem = $(#my-element);這里,$ 是 jQuery 的一個別名,它接受一個 CSS 選擇器作為參數(shù),并返回匹配的元素集合的 jQuery 對象。
4、其實(shí)看明白上面的例子,就知道錯在哪里了:很簡單,this操作的是HTML對象,那么,HTML對象中怎么會有val()方法了,所以,在使用中,我們不能直接用this來直接調(diào)用jquery的方法或者屬性。
1、jquery。(div[id=aa][class=bb])就是選擇id = aa 且 class為bb的div 當(dāng)然條件不一點(diǎn)非得是等號 (div[id=aa][class$=bb])就是選擇id = aa 且 class以bb結(jié)尾的div。
2、在CSS3選擇器標(biāo)淮定義的選擇器語法中,jQuery支持相當(dāng)完整的一套子集,同時還添加了一些非標(biāo)準(zhǔn)但很有用的偽類。注意:本節(jié)講述的是 jQuery選擇器。其中有不少選擇器(但不是全部)可以在CSS樣式表中使用。
3、).prevaAll() 當(dāng)前元素之前所有的兄弟節(jié)點(diǎn)$(#id).next() 當(dāng)前元素之后第一個兄弟節(jié)點(diǎn)$(#id).nextAll() 當(dāng)前元素之后所有的兄弟節(jié)點(diǎn)這三個方法都可以添加選擇器,給出選擇條件,就能找到你指定的兄弟節(jié)點(diǎn)了。
4、例如,可以通過以下方式獲取一個 jQuery 對象:var $elem = $(#my-element);這里,$ 是 jQuery 的一個別名,它接受一個 CSS 選擇器作為參數(shù),并返回匹配的元素集合的 jQuery 對象。
5、(1)jQuery對象是一個數(shù)據(jù)對象,可以通過[index]的方法,來得到相應(yīng)的DOM對象。
ajax傳遞不了實(shí)體類,一般用json封裝好對象和數(shù)據(jù)傳遞過去在拆分就行了。
但是可以使用JSON字符串來實(shí)現(xiàn),在后臺把JSON字符串解析成JAVA對象。
可以考慮在前臺將對象分解成固定格式的字符串,然后在服務(wù)器端將分解后的字符串做成你想要的對象類型。
params 可以是字符串也可以是Map格式的數(shù)據(jù)。
jquery的ajax可以設(shè)置回調(diào)函數(shù)?;卣{(diào)函數(shù) 如果要處理$.ajax()得到的數(shù)據(jù),則需要使用回調(diào)函數(shù)。beforeSend、error、dataFilter、success、complete。beforeSend 在發(fā)送請求之前調(diào)用,并且傳入一個XMLHttpRequest作為參數(shù)。
jQuery中ajax的4種常用請求方式:$.ajax()返回其創(chuàng)建的 XMLHttpRequest 對象。$.ajax() 只有一個參數(shù):參數(shù) key/value 對象,包含各配置及回調(diào)函數(shù)信息。詳細(xì)參數(shù)選項(xiàng)見下。
客戶首次訪問服務(wù)器的一個頁面時,服務(wù)器就會為該客戶分配一個session對象,同時為該session對象指定一個唯一的ID,并且將該ID號發(fā)送到客戶端并寫入到cookie中,使得客戶端與服務(wù)器端的session建立一一對應(yīng)關(guān)系。
創(chuàng)建空的asp點(diǎn)虐 mvc項(xiàng)目。添加頁面1)添加HomeController2)添加Index頁面3)添加Content文件夾,并添加Jquery源文件(jquery-1min.js)。
jQuery 底層 AJAX 實(shí)現(xiàn)。簡單易用的高層實(shí)現(xiàn)見 .get,.post 等。.ajax()返回其創(chuàng)建的XMLHttpRequest對象。大多數(shù)情況下你無需直接操作該對象,但特殊情況下可用于手動終止請求。
該方法是 jQuery 底層 AJAX 實(shí)現(xiàn)。簡單易用的高層實(shí)現(xiàn)見 $.get, $.post 等。$.ajax() 返回其創(chuàng)建的 XMLHttpRequest 對象。大多數(shù)情況下你無需直接操作該函數(shù),除非你需要操作不常用的選項(xiàng),以獲得更多的靈活性。
(1)jQuery對象是一個數(shù)據(jù)對象,可以通過[index]的方法,來得到相應(yīng)的DOM對象。
該功能很強(qiáng)大,還單獨(dú)分離出來sizzle模塊供只需用到選擇器功能的朋友使用。
(elem)[0],或 (elem).get(0)注:jQ對象保存的是一個數(shù)組,每個元素都是Dom對象的引用,訪問該元素索引值即可獲取該Dom元素DOM對象轉(zhuǎn)jQ對象-- (domElem)如果domElem是dom元素,直接用$()包裹起來即可轉(zhuǎn)為jQ對象。
深刻了解jQuery對象和普通DOM對象的區(qū)別。
jQuery對象不能使用DOM中的方法,但是如果對jQuery對象所提供的方法不熟悉,或者jQuery沒有封裝想要的方法,不得不實(shí)用DOM對象的時候,有以下兩種處理方法。
1、要獲取一個 jQuery 對象,需要使用 jQuery 提供的 $ 或 jQuery 函數(shù)。這兩個函數(shù)是等價的,可以互相替換使用。
2、jQuery如此之好用,和其在獲取對象時使用與CSS選擇器兼容的語法有很大關(guān)系,畢竟CSS選擇器大家都很熟悉(關(guān)于CSS選擇器可以看看十分鐘搞定CSS選擇器),但其強(qiáng)大在兼容了CSS3的選擇器,甚至多出了很多。
3、jQuery通過name獲取對象的方法是:使用jQuery獲取name=nw的input對象:$(input[name=nw]);使用$(input[name=nw]).val()方法或$(input[name=nw]).html()方法來獲取其值。
4、(1)jQuery對象是一個數(shù)據(jù)對象,可以通過[index]的方法,來得到相應(yīng)的DOM對象。